使用 Node.js 将 RTF 转换为 ODT

富文本格式 (RTF) 广泛用于文档交换,但在某些情况下,为了与开源办公应用程序兼容,需要将其转换为开放文档文本 (ODT)。使用正确的方法,您可以有效地使用 Node.js 将 RTF 转换为 ODT,同时保留文档的格式。通过使用强大的文档处理库,此任务变得无缝,无需额外依赖即可顺利完成转换。无论是单个文件还是批量处理,此方法都能确保可靠的结果。在本指南中,我们将逐步介绍在 Node.js 中轻松将 RTF 导出到 ODT的步骤。

使用 Node.js 将 RTF 转换为 ODT 的步骤

  1. 安装并设置 通过 Java 为 Node.js 进行 GroupDocs.Conversion 以促进 RTF 到 ODT 文件的转换
  2. 将 groupdocs.conversion 模块集成到您的项目中以激活文档转换功能
  3. 通过指定文件位置来实例化 Converter 类,以导入 RTF 文档进行处理
  4. 配置 WordProcessingConvertOptions 并通过相应地设置 WordProcessingFileType 将 ODT 指定为目标格式
  5. 使用配置的选项调用 Converter.convert 方法将 RTF 文档转换为 ODT 文件

为了实现准确的格式转换,我们将使用高级文档转换库。该过程包括初始化所需的包、加载输入 RTF 文件以及配置 ODT 的输出设置。设置后,转换函数将在保持文本结构、字体和布局的同时执行转换。此外,此方法支持各种格式元素,如粗体、斜体、表格和图像,确保输出与原始文档非常相似的高质量内容。此方法对于需要自动文档转换的应用程序非常有用,例如内容管理系统、基于云的编辑工具和数字存档解决方案。以下代码片段演示了如何将其集成到 Node.js 应用程序中,从而轻松在 Node.js 中从 RTF 生成 ODT

使用 Node.js 将 RTF 转换为 ODT 的代码

将 RTF 文件转换为 ODT 格式可确保更大的灵活性,尤其是在使用开源办公应用程序时。通过实施可靠的文档转换方法,用户可以维护文本结构、字体和格式,同时确保无缝兼容性。无论是个人使用还是企业级自动化,此方法都可以简化文档处理并增强可访问性。通过结构良好的工作流程,如何使用 Node.js 将 RTF 更改为 ODT 的过程成为满足现代文档管理需求的高效且可扩展的解决方案。

之前,我们提供了一个全面的教程,详细解释了使用 Node.js 将 RTF 文件转换为 HTML 的过程。本指南将引导您完成每个步骤,确保转换过程顺利高效,同时保持原始文档的结构和格式。如果您正在寻找整个过程的详细分解,包括代码实现和最佳实践,我们强烈建议您阅读我们的深入文章。要获取有关如何 使用 Node.js 将 RTF 转换为 HTML 的完整分步说明,请访问链接并按照指南进行操作。

 简体中文